Small flute armadillos

Allan always talks about the minute errors people have to fix in their forms. He calls them something I have always heard as "piccadillo". I thought he was being funny, calling their problems "small armadillos". Piccolo being "small" and armadillo being... well... an armadillo. Like having a monkey on one's back or a white elephant or a thousand other animal phrases.

However, the Word of the Day on my Google homepage today was "peccadillo", defined as "a slight offense or petty fault" so I guess that's what he's been saying all along. But I think I like my version better.
